Engineering Laboratory Design, Inc.
Is
located in Lake City, Minnesota, approximately 70 miles southeast
of the twin cities of Minneapolis/St. Paul along the Mississippi
river. ELD occupies a 10,000 sq. ft. office and manufacturing facility
in a light industrial park on the south side of Lake City just off
US Highway 61.

History
In 1962
S. H. Anderson introduced the first hydraulic demonstration channel
while a Research Fellow at the University of Minnesota's St.
Anthony Falls Hydraulics Laboratory. While teaching, he recognized
the need for quality laboratory equipment which would demonstrate
the basics of civil engineering hydraulics and provide the student
with a springboard for more in depth investigations. To facilitate
the manufacture of this equipment, he established Hydraulic Design
& Products Co. from his residence in a Minneapolis suburb.
The product line soon expanded to include other proprietary design
student laboratory apparatus and related equipment for aeronautical,
chemical, civil and mechanical engineering institutions. To reflect
these changes the company was renamed and incorporated in 1966 under
the name Engineering Laboratory Design. The first wind tunnel was
manufactured in 1968 and the first water tunnel in 1986.
In 1972 ELD moved from our original facility in Golden Valley, Minnesota
to our present location. While the original product line continues,
the company has developed additional educational and research apparatus
and contracted larger, custom designed, laboratory projects for
institutions in the U.S.A and overseas, thus expanding ELD's manufacturing
capabilities, products, and services worldwide. ELD Inc. is currently
owned by Sigurd W. Anderson, Gordon K.Anderson, and Kurt A. Banaszynski.
What
we do
We are
a recognized industry leader in the design and manufacture of custom
and standard fluid dynamics equipment including: wind tunnels, water
tunnels, hydraulic demonstration and sediment channels and AMCA/ASHRAE
fan test apparatus. We supply turn-key equipment installations for
research and educational institutions and manufacturing industry
worldwide.

Engineering
Resources
Our engineering
staff is comprised of engineers with degrees in aerospace and mechanical
fields and extensive experience in civil engineering hydraulics.
We are experienced in fluid mechanics, composites and traditional
structures, mechanisms, hydraulics, pneumatics, instrumentation
and data acquisition, electrical controls and various molding methods.
Computer aided design is used to accelerate the design process and
analysis of simple and complex projects. Our engineers are involved
in all stages of product development, from initial concept, through
design, manufacturing and installation. This hands on approach allows
our designs to continually evolve whereby simplifying the manufacturing
process and reducing costs.
Manufacturing
Resources
ELD's
manufacturing expertise covers a wide variety of materials, methods
and techniques. Our manufacturing capabilities include construction
of wood and composite molds and tooling, precision machining, sheet
metal forming, MIG and TIG welding and electrical assemblies. We
are experienced in precision molding of fiberglass shapes including
PVC foam sandwich construction and carbon fiber reinforcements.
Our skilled craftsmen are cross-trained in all work centers which
allows for greater efficiency and flexibility.
